I got the ones from rdana off of Ebay. These supposedly will work with roughly 80% of the Maha C9000s out there, but were also designed with the Opus BT-3400/3100.

I paid $8 delivered for them, if that.

I think that they actually stayed put in my Maha, but sometimes popped out on my Opus 3400 when I fiddled with them upon receipt. I don't have any D NiMH batteries yet, so I can't say how they work in real life.

The Maha C9000 has an maximum charged capacity of 4000mah energy put into the battery, So if you factor in an 90% efficiency it can only charge up maximum 3600mah AA battery`s if they are ever released, So if you want to charge an 5000mah or higher C or D cell using an adapter you will have run more than 1 charging cycle.

EDIT: The 4000mah limit does not apply to break-in mode.
